    Aspirations,of,Life:Tree of Life

      After entering Senior Three, besides strenuous revisions and examinations, what the students think most and discuss most is aspirations of life. As far as I know, most of my classmates have already specified their choices of majors and their aspirations of life. Some classmates excel in science subjects, so they have chosen science and engineering subjects, hoping that they will become scientists or engineers. Some students have artistic talents, so they have chosen arts and designs. Besides, some other students have chosen accounting or media.
      What should I choose? This is a question asked more than once by my parents and teachers and a question I have kept asking myself. But frankly speaking, I am not fully prepared yet.
      First of all, I am not as outstanding in any subject as to win any national or provincial awards. Besides, with my age and intelligence, I may not be able to determine my aspirations of life now. Of course, this surely does not mean that I do not have any pursuit in life. I think it might be more desirable to learn some basic subjects well in arts and sciences colleges to improve one’s quality and thinking ability before determining one’s major in the university. In my opinion, besides selecting majors, it is more important to foster positive outlooks on life and values in the university.
      My father was a medicine major and obtained his doctor’s degree. Then he became a university teacher. After he was promoted to associate professor, he gave up his major to go into business. He did so well that he became a vice president of one of the largest pharmaceutical companies in China. However, he resigned from this job again. By taking advantage of his experience accumulated over the years in the enterprise and his extensive contacts and resources, he engaged in risk investment to help those young people full of entrepreneurial passion but short of funds and management experience to realize their dreams. My father tells me that what he concerns most is not how many investment returns he can get but that he can work with those passionate pioneering entrepreneurs every day. It is his biggest joy to help them, with his experience and resources, to realize their dreams and share their successes and setbacks in their entrepreneurial undertakings. My father’s experiences tell me that one’s major in university will not necessarily become one’s lifelong career.
      I know there are usually two career paths, i.e., professional and all-round ones. Maybe I will not choose professional jobs such as lawyer, accountant or engineer. But I know I have my own strong points and will cultivate my own development orientation accordingly. I am outgoing, good at communications and keen on various jobs involving people. Besides, I have good organizing ability. As a major leader of the Students’ Union, I have organized many activities, big or small, and initiated some societies. Therefore, management, human resources, marketing, and business majors may be more suitable to me. I also know that the key is not what you do, but that you really love the job and try your best to do it well.
      I love life and my family. I will still be well contented if I have tried my best in the future but failed to achieve the success in ordinary people’s eyes, without luxury residence or goods, without high-end cars or jewelry, but with a houseful of books, rich memories and wonderful experiences with my family and friends.
      Not long ago, I initiated an activity to offer healthcare and medicine to the senior people in a rural resthome and established health files for them. I think this is of great significance, because I have not only helped the old people, but benefited a lot myself. Therefore, I have realized that the career I choose is not important or even the success I have achieved in common people’s eyes is not so important. What really matters is that I am a useful person to the society, because I can help people around me and make the world better and more wonderful.
